Transaction 7c66b75559932f84399ebf25f02c438589aedcbd12646edc2a5b3fb12a0e387a
1 Input
1 Output
-
7c66b75559932f84399ebf25f02c438589aedcbd12646edc2a5b3fb12a0e387a:0
- value
- 1040634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fca83d088ad6f48072c1eadd5c06ca62e26ce1f OP_EQUAL
- address
- 3KB7bAYUt1hNxFVdtKH8QvqAZAbT13uDmT